Product Highlights
- DESIGN INSPIRATION: Celebrate the beauty of nature with this ring studded with a magnificent fossilised tree resin
- ABOUT THE GEMSTONE: It is formed when the tree sap collects over the bark and doesn't erodes with time but turns into a hardened resin
- PLATING: The jewel is set over a shank plated in rhodium for a spectacular sheen
- WEIGHT: Our impeccable design is crafted from 4.87 grams of sterling silver
- SETTING: The large oval amber set on the ring is clasped by bezel setting with undulating outer frame
- INCLUSIONS: Eccentric inclusions of amber can serve as a time capsule when they are foliage or insects from the ancient times
